基于蚁群算法的超大规模集成电路布线研究的开题报告.docx
上传人:快乐****蜜蜂 上传时间:2024-09-14 格式:DOCX 页数:3 大小:11KB 金币:5 举报 版权申诉
预览加载中,请您耐心等待几秒...

基于蚁群算法的超大规模集成电路布线研究的开题报告.docx

基于蚁群算法的超大规模集成电路布线研究的开题报告.docx

预览

在线预览结束,喜欢就下载吧,查找使用更方便

5 金币

下载此文档

如果您无法下载资料,请参考说明:

1、部分资料下载需要金币,请确保您的账户上有足够的金币

2、已购买过的文档,再次下载不重复扣费

3、资料包下载后请先用软件解压,在使用对应软件打开

基于蚁群算法的超大规模集成电路布线研究的开题报告一、研究背景及意义随着集成电路技术的不断发展,集成度不断提高,电路规模越来越大,战略重要的集成电路系统更需要快速、高效的设计与布局。而集成电路布局是电路设计过程中不可或缺的步骤。合理的布局不仅可以保证电路正常的工作,而且可以使电路性能达到最优。因此,集成电路布局技术的研究一直是学术界和工业界关注的热点。超大规模集成电路布线问题是一种NP难问题,其解决不仅需要高效的算法,还需要运用大量的计算资源来支撑布线过程。因此,如何找到高效的算法并在大规模计算环境下实现,成为了集成电路布局领域的重要研究方向。蚁群算法(ACO)是一种模拟蚂蚁寻找食物路径的算法,具有全局搜索能力、自适应性、并行性等优点。算法在旅行商问题、作业调度问题等领域有广泛应用。近年来,ACO被应用于集成电路布线问题中,取得了一定的研究成果。然而,现有的研究大多停留在小规模电路布线问题上,对于超大规模电路布线问题的研究还需要加强。因此,本研究旨在利用蚁群算法求解超大规模集成电路布线问题,提高电路布局效率和布线质量,为电路设计提供有力支撑和保障。二、研究内容和方法本研究拟基于蚁群算法,探索超大规模集成电路布线问题的解决方法,具体内容包括:1.研究超大规模集成电路布线问题的特点、难点及算法求解思路,分析现有研究中存在的问题和不足。2.基于蚁群算法,设计适合高效处理大规模计算任务的并行算法。使用Pthreads等工具实现算法的并行化,优化算法的计算性能。3.与现有算法进行对比实验,评估算法的布线效率、质量及计算效率。为实际应用提供技术支持和方法借鉴。四、预期成果和意义预期成果包括:1.研究超大规模集成电路布线问题的特点、难点及算法求解思路,为相关领域的理论研究提供依据。2.基于蚁群算法,设计适用于大规模计算任务的并行算法,优化算法计算能力。3.对比实验评估算法的效率和优化程度,比较基于蚁群算法的解决方案与其他算法的优劣性。4.研究成果可为集成电路设计领域提供技术支持,提升布线问题的解决效率和实际应用水平。五、研究进度安排本研究进度安排如下:1.第一阶段:2022年3月-2022年5月。完成对超大规模集成电路布线问题的研究,并分析算法求解思路和现有研究中存在的问题。2.第二阶段:2022年6月-2022年12月。基于蚁群算法,设计适用于大规模计算任务的并行算法,并实现算法的并行化处理和计算优化。3.第三阶段:2023年1月-2023年6月。进行对比实验,评估算法的效率和优化程度,并比较基于蚁群算法的解决方案与其他算法的优劣性。4.第四阶段:2023年7月-2023年9月。完成论文撰写和答辩准备。六、参考文献[1]LarbaniM,BendraouR,GhanemiS.Antcolonyoptimizationforthebusassignmentprobleminon-chipcommunication.MicroelectronicsJournal,2009,40(1):217-223.[2]AboulhamidEM,SaitSM.Gradient-basedglobalroutingforgeneralcell-baseddesigns.IEEETransactionsonComputer-AidedDesignofIntegratedCircuitsandSystems,1994,13(4):464-476.[3]StutzkeRD,JohnsonDB,VenkatramanS.Amultilevelalgorithmforglobalroutingoflarge-scaleintegratedcircuits.IEEETransactionsonComputer-AidedDesignofIntegratedCircuitsandSystems,1991,10(9):1186-1198.[4]LiuW,Abdel-MalekM,GaoY,etal.EnhancingtheperformanceofdynamicroutingforFPGAsthroughmulti-objectiveantcolonyoptimization.JournalofComputationalScience,2018,28:33-41.